Transaction f7707788773730b2b8a29d80a3bd0d78eee331d150c77e963808437ccdde011c
2 Input
2 Outputs
- f7707788773730b2b8a29d80a3bd0d78eee331d150c77e963808437ccdde011c:0
- f7707788773730b2b8a29d80a3bd0d78eee331d150c77e963808437ccdde011c:1
value 855868
address 35ai6kuNLvm7GRnfm8pXaKpiBUEEc7z34b
value 35496
address 1NAbYSPAL696sabdB8xxg1y33ZqHhAqKgY